If you're figured out, dedicated, and hard-working, review on to figure out exactly how to locate a job as an orthodontist. U.S. Information reports that orthodontists earned a mean salary of $208,000 in 2018. Lower-paid orthodontists make around $142,470. Research study from the Bureau of Labor Data (BLS) found that in 2019, the typical income had actually reached $230,830.




Zipcrecruiter has actually put together a table of average orthodontist wages by state to compare salaries in your location. Orthodontists are certified dental professionals that focus on the art of properly straightening teeth for much better dental wellness, better total health, extra effective and comfy bite, and greater smile self-confidence. Each patients' instance is distinct, so orthodontists have to have a broad understanding and experience in a wide range of therapy strategies and appliances.


In enhancement to collaborating with patients, orthodontists are commonly responsible for leading a team of oral professionals, which needs directing and supervising dental assistants and hygienists, and functioning with office supervisors to keep the workplace running smoothly. Those orthodontists who go into personal method will certainly also be accountable for the numerous elements of small company ownership, consisting of paying taxes and office rental fees, tracking budgets, working with, supervising, and discipling team, and far more.


That's since all orthodontists are, in truth, dentists: they full oral institution and ending up being accredited dental experts before going on to specialize via a residency program. Oral institution is typically 4 years: candidates have to have completed undergraduate education and take the Oral Evaluation Test (DAT). The examination is scored on a range from 1-30, with the ordinary score being 17.

Since straight teeth and wellness grins location always sought after, orthodontists enjoy sunny task expectations for the near future. According to U.S. Information, The Bureau of Labor Stats, which tracks job development and tasks numbers for the future, expects orthodontic work to expand by 7.3% between 2018 and 2028, with an estimated 500 new tasks opening.

Orthodontist frequently work permanent, however there are alternatives for part-time work, including for semi-retired orthodontists. Every workplace routines in a different way: some larger methods are open 7 days a week, with a revolving team of orthodontists and assistants that take turns functioning weekends. Others are just open Monday through Friday, or for sure hours on certain days.

All orthodontist workplaces are required to abide by state and government health and wellness guidelines, to protect personnel and patients in a medical setting. There are a selection of expert alternatives for orthodontists: As a participant of an orthodontic team, you will certainly have your very own caseload of individuals yet job under a managing orthodontist or scientific supervisor.


Several orthodontists start out as component of a group method, but go on to start their own business or companion with 1 or 2 other orthodontists. This makes them both practicing orthodontists and local business proprietors, employing a small team of oral assistants, hygienists, and/or workplace managers to aid them see and handle people.


Practice possession likewise calls for looking after stringent conformity with state and government regulations for patient and staff health and wellness and security, medical personal privacy, labor methods, and more. Most of professionals handle financial debt in order to open up a workplace, so there are big economic threats entailed. Starting your very own orthodontic technique is financially dangerous and a demanding life course, yet a successful personal practice can produce much greater salaries and work flexibility, especially if your technique broadens by hiring even more orthodontists.

Some orthodontists work part-time for a variety of dental workplaces, traveling to different offices throughout the week. Operating in a general dental practitioner's office has drawbacks, however: the orthodontist must think the dangers and responsibilities for all orthodontic patients, given that the dental expert depends upon the orthodontist for dealing with these individuals and offering connection of care.

Furthermore, orthodontists must presume all conformity risks of general dental care, such as documents maintaining, informed approval, HIPPA, and extra


Due to the dangers simply described, it is very important to investigate a basic dental professional method extensively before joining as an orthodontist. While orthodontic treatment can be costly and lots of people pay out-of-pocket, there are a variety of health care organizations that provide affordable or totally free orthodontic care to low-income family members. Orthodontists can work in a community health and wellness center that supplies low-priced oral solutions, consisting of orthodontics.
